Output e9330115120c7a5bd78d264fba91c1ed3326704850b5ac0a23d1a77cfa95a928:98

value
519188
script pubkey
OP_0 OP_PUSHBYTES_32 096a62c4b9f91971080303ea74fed065e1b0a00a3dd28491c03cebcb2e04dba5
address
bc1qp94x939elyvhzzqrq048flksvhsmpgq28hfgfywq8n4uktsymwjszzwezn
transaction
e9330115120c7a5bd78d264fba91c1ed3326704850b5ac0a23d1a77cfa95a928
confirmations
703
spent
false

6 Sat Ranges